Performance and Power
The VQ35 engine in the Nissan Murano delivers robust efficiency and power, making it a standout selection in the midsize SUV sector. This 3.5-liter V6 engine creates an excellent output of approximately 260 horsepower and 240 lb-ft of torque, guaranteeing that the Murano can manage a selection of driving problems with simplicity. Its responsive velocity enables confident merging and surpassing on highways, while the engine's smooth operation improves the general driving experience.
The VQ35 is geared up with sophisticated modern technologies such as variable valve timing, which maximizes performance across different RPM varieties. This results in a balanced combination of power and smoothness, enabling motorists to take pleasure in a dynamic yet fine-tuned experience. Furthermore, the engine's layout decreases vibrations and sound, contributing to a quieter cabin atmosphere.
Additionally, the Murano's transmission alternatives, consisting of a constantly variable transmission (CVT), work effortlessly with the VQ35 engine to make sure efficient power distribution. This integration boosts the automobile's handling and responsiveness, offering a driving experience that is both pleasurable and interesting. Overall, the VQ35 engine solidifies the Nissan Murano's track record as a effective and capable midsize SUV.
Gas Effectiveness
Just how effective is the VQ35 engine in the Nissan Murano when it involves sustain consumption? The VQ35 engine, a 3.5-liter V6, balances power and effectiveness, making it a perfect selection for a midsize crossover like the Murano. This engine usually accomplishes an EPA-rated gas economy of approximately 20 miles per gallon (mpg) in the city and as much as 28 mpg on the highway, depending on driving problems and upkeep.
Among the standout features of the VQ35 is its advanced technology, including dual overhead camshafts and variable shutoff timing, which enhance gas distribution and burning performance. This not only boosts performance but likewise contributes to far better gas economic climate. In addition, the engine's lightweight building and construction and wind resistant design of the Murano further enhance its performance, permitting chauffeurs to cover more range per gallon.
Moreover, the VQ35's style lessens engine friction, which is important in achieving superior fuel efficiency.
